Responsibilities
  • Provide critical help chain for manufacturing to reduce downtime of critical manufacturing equipment
  • Create, verify and release robot programs for automated cells
  • Create, verify and release programs for other programmable manufacturing equipment
  • Design and deliver tooling and fixtures for manufacturing processes
  • Create supporting documentation for automated equipment (SOP and EMS)
  • Support implementation of new advanced manufacturing equipment and automation
  • Support Senior MEs in justification of capital funding requests
  • Support cost reduction and process improvement of current manufacturing techniques
  • Work with Manufacturing to record and improve OEE of critical equipment
  • Support implementation of new manufacturing technology
  • Responsible for program storage, data back‑ups and revision control for Manufacturing equipment
  • Implement and support EH&S activities
  • Prioritize product demands, process control tasks and manufacturing engineering responsibilities to fulfil business needs across all Business Centers
  • Maintain focus on supporting production while implementing new products and process improvements
  • Quality control of work instruction documentation and product criteria
  • Work with Maintenance to fault‑find manufacturing systems
  • Direct reporting to Manufacturing Engineering Lead who reports to Engineering Manager; the primary customer is Manufacturing, led by Operations Manager
  • Work within Engineering to provide engineered solutions to Manufacturing problems
  • Determine priorities
Qualifications
  • High school diploma or GED from an accredited institution
  • A minimum of 3 years’ relevant experience within an engineering environment
  • Good understanding of tooling, fixture design and manufacturing processes
  • Proficient in CAD, Siemens NX an advantage
  • Ability to read engineering drawings
  • High level of computer literacy (Word/Excel/Project)
  • Good judgment and decision making
  • Communication and team working skills
